13 Killed After Massive Rock Crushes Vehicle in Lahaul-Spiti


A devastating road accident occurred on Friday in Himachal Pradesh's Lahaul-Spiti district, where a Tata Sumo taxi was struck by massive rocks falling from a hillside near Kadu Nala on the Udaipur-Killar (Tandi-Sansari National Highway). The incident claimed the lives of 13 people.

According to preliminary information, around 14 people, including the driver, were travelling in the vehicle. The passengers had reportedly stayed overnight in Tindi after the road remained closed a day earlier. Once the route reopened, they resumed their journey toward Pangi, but the vehicle was hit by falling rocks and debris.

Rescue teams from the Border Roads Organisation (BRO), local police, and district administration immediately reached the accident site. The rescue operation continues under challenging conditions due to continuous landslides and bad weather.

Authorities have not yet officially confirmed the identities of the victims. The administration has urged the public to rely only on official updates and avoid sharing or believing unverified information.

Jantar Mantar Restored After Massive 12-Hour Cleanup Drive

  • Following the conclusion of the CJP protest, the New Delhi Municipal Council (NDMC) carried out a large-scale cleanup operation at Jantar Mantar and surrounding areas. Officials said over 60 metric tonnes of waste were removed and damaged public infrastructure was restored within 12 hours.
